minded
Adjective
/ˈmaɪndɪd/

Definition
Having a particular tendency or inclination in terms of thoughts or attitudes.

Examples
- She is very open-minded and enjoys hearing different perspectives.
- His closed-minded attitude makes it difficult for him to accept new ideas.
- They are government-minded individuals who prioritize public policy discussions.

Meaning
The term ‘minded’ refers to being oriented towards a specific way of thinking or feeling, often described in phrases such as ‘open-minded’ or ‘closed-minded.’
